I purchased one on the 24th of August and first set it up on Sunday the 27th August. I went through the autotune and menus fine but then when scrolling up through the channels got stuck on channel 9 with the picture frozen (Sunday program was on at the time). At this point no control on the remote would respond other than the power off. I bypassed the problem by powering off, removing antenna, powering on, changing channel, powering off, reconnecting antenna and then powering on again. I had to avoid all channel nines channels including HD. I called JB ($3000 with a 5 year warranty BTW) to return and they said they had had a flood of calls on the units and had none left in stock. By the time the footy show was on the problem was gone. I figured it was some sort of compatibility issue between the broadcaster and the firmware and gave it no more thought. It has operated seemlessly since.

I now have a new problem, aparantly a timing issue with the ignition which is leaving several areas of the screen with hazy blue tinges during certain conditions like a blue of white image. I am currently waiting on a new screen. When the Tech came this Friday I mentioned the initial freezing problem. He was more than aware of the problem and even quoted the date (27/08/06) that it occurred. Apparantly Nine was not monitoring their signal output to carefully.

Ok, I have CPU ver 3.03.0 and

Micom Ver 03.00

The odd thing is that I have already taken my plasma to an LG service center for the 'upgrade'. They stated they had not done one of these models before, and so I wonder if they actually used the current version of the firmware to upgrade....

Can anyone else here owning one of these please post these details, as well as if it is pre-service or post-service upgrade?

The HD channel seems a bit poor to me, and I didnt really notice much difference before or after the service.

I've suffered the same fate as BRISBULL. After 7 weeks of hassle I've just had "the" upgrade done only to find that it's gone from 3.01 to 3.03 and there's still no difference in PQ between SD and HD.

It's my guess that the firmware version on the website that the LG service agents download from is still at 3.03 when it should be at 3.23 or higher. So beware! If anyone goes for the upgrade be sure to stress that you want v3.23 or higher, otherwise you'll be very disappointed.
